The Impact You’ll Make in this Role
 

As a Europe Middle East Africa Marketing Assistant and Event Coordinator for the Health Information Systems business, you will provide a blend of marketing event coordination, trade show support, and executive administrative support across multiple business teams in Europe. You will help coordinate internal team meetings and business events, support external marketing events and trade shows, and manage the administrative details that help regional teams operate efficiently.

You will have the opportunity to tap into your curiosity and collaborate with colleagues across EMEA, business leaders, marketing teams, event suppliers, venues, and external partners to help deliver well-organized internal and external meetings, marketing programs, and trade show experiences.

In this role you will:

  • Coordinate marketing events and external trade shows, including event registration, booth coordination, vendor and venue logistics, timelines, materials, attendee support, and post-event follow-up.

  • Coordinate internal team meetings, business meetings, and regional events for EMEA business leaders, including meeting rooms, hotel blocks, catering, agenda support, travel coordination, and on-site or virtual meeting logistics.

  • Support approximately seven marketers and their business partners with administrative tasks connected to marketing activities, campaign execution, event preparation, purchase orders, vendor coordination, scheduling, and follow-up activities.

Your Skills and Expertise 
 

To set you up for success in this role from day one, Solventum requires (at a minimum) the following q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ree or higher in marketing, business, communications, or a related field and 2 years of experience in event coordination, marketing operations, trade show  support, or executive administrative support.

  • High School Diploma/GED from AND (5) years of experience in trade shows, events, field marketing operations, or executive administrative support with ownership of logistics in private, public, government, or military environments.

In addition to the above requirements, the following are also required:

  • Proven organizational skills and experience managing multiple projects, schedules, and competing priorities simultaneously.

  • Experience working with external vendors, agencies, and suppliers.

  • Experience supporting a regional or international marketing organization.

  • Experience with event registration platforms, CRM systems, and marketing automation tools.

  • Experience managing travel arrangements, internal and external meetings, executive calendars, agendas, meeting materials, and follow-up actions.

  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office, Teams, Outlook, Excel, and PowerPoint.

Additional qualifications that could help you succeed even further in this role include:

  • Knowledge of the German language (and / or) French.  

  • Experience in healthcare, technology, or B2B marketing environments.

  • Strong attention to detail and follow-through.

  • Ability to work independently with limited supervision.

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.

  • Ability to remain calm and flexible in a fast-paced event environment.

  • Experience negotiating and coordinating with event venues, hotels, and suppliers.

  • Proficiency with AI solutions like Copilot
